Jessa Seewald Says New Baby Doesn’t Have A Name Five Days After Birth, Duggar Fans Continue To Wait


There seems to be a good reason that Ben and Jessa Seewald have not announced the name of their new bundle of joy to waiting Duggar fans. The pair say they have not named the 5-day-old baby yet. Jessa confirmed to fans on her social media accounts that the couple is still trying to decide on the perfect name, and will announce once they settle on one. Grandma Guinn Seewald also confirmed that the baby remains nameless by noting that she simply calls him “dearheart.”

With baby Seewald still nameless, Duggar fans are soaking up all of the new details being provided of the latest Duggar grandchild’s birth. Though baby Seewald is doing great, the birth was not without issues. In fact, a 911 was made by Michelle Duggar on the night of the birth, noting that Jessa was “bleeding heavily” and that she needed evaluation from a medical team. The new mother was rushed to the hospital in an ambulance, but appears to be feeling better now. Jessa made her first social media post last night since the birth, indicating that she is enjoying time as a new mother.

Though an official name for baby Seewald is still up in the air, one thing has been revealed by the new family. Prior to the birth, Jessa and Ben said that they would not be continuing the Duggar tradition of selecting a letter theme for their family. Instead they noted that they would likely choose another theme such as family names or Christian heroes. Jill Dillard, another Duggar daughter, also opted out of choosing a letter theme for her son. Instead, she went with the unique name of Israel.
